Three months ago I was fortunate to have the opportunity to purchase a CCM 404 DS that had quite a history attached to it.
John (Pembroke) Halstead sadly died earlier this year and hence the bike became available, it had not run in over a year as John had moved onto newer metal and the CCM had fallen into disrepair. Up for a challenge and wanting a small bike to join the local trail riders discovering the joys of the Welsh lanes the challenge is on.
